On 9/30/2022 7:05 AM, James Kuyper wrote:
> On 9/30/22 00:48, Lynn McGuire wrote:
>> Is this C++ statement using the comma operator ?
>>
>>         write(6, "(3(1x,i3),1x,f12.6,1x,f12.6)"), hkl(1, i), hkl(2, i),
>>           hkl(3, i), f_calc(1, i), f_calc(2, i);
>>
>> There is a large open source template library supporting this statement
>> from Fortran to C++ Fable software.
> 
> 
> 
> If write, hkl, and f_calc are macros, you cannot be sure without
> examining the macro definitions. However, if any of those three is an
> ordinary function, it seems to me that this statement does unnecessarily
> use the comma operator.
> 

"unnecessarily" is not necessarily true here: others have mentioned an 
overloaded comma operator.
/If/ this is what is actually going on here, then you might need to keep 
the sequence of commas in place, or go through some nontrivial rewrite.
